1.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is the origin of the obturator internus?
Back
The obturator internus originates from the obturator membrane and the inferior surface of the obturator foramen.
2.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Between which two muscles are the hamstrings situated?
Back
The hamstrings are situated directly between the vastus lateralis and the adductor magnus.
3.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Where does the gemellus inferior insert?
Back
The gemellus inferior inserts on the medial surface of the greater trochanter.
4.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Which muscle connects the anterior surfaces of the lumbar vertebrae to the lesser trochanter?
Back
The psoas major connects the anterior surfaces of the lumbar vertebrae to the lesser trochanter.
5.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What hip movement lengthens the fibers of the gluteus minimus?
Back
Adduction of the hip lengthens the fibers of the gluteus minimus.
6.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is the primary function of the obturator internus muscle?
Back
The primary function of the obturator internus muscle is to laterally rotate the hip.
7.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What are the main components of the hamstring muscle group?
Back
The main components of the hamstring muscle group are the biceps femoris, semitendinosus, and semimembranosus.
